Frequently Asked Questions About Singapore Maths

Here are a few questions about Singapore Mathematics frequently asked by many people.

#1 What is Singapore Mathematics?

The development of the Singapore Math framework is around the idea of learning to problem-solve and develop mathematical thinking. It considers these factors to be crucial to success in math. Students won't have anything to draw on from increasingly complicated math learning without a solid foundational base. #3 How do instructors approach Singapore Maths?

Teaching Singapore Math follows a Concrete, Pictorial, Abstract (CPA) approach. CPA helps students understand math by building on existing knowledge. In the concrete phase, you will encourage students to interact with physical objects to work out problems. #4 How is Singapore Maths different from Maths worldwide?

Singapore Math teaches students how to use their brains and do not drill concepts through similar problems. It trains students to not rely on rote memorisation. The subject teaches students how to mathematically think to rely on the theory and build on concepts in various ways, rather than memorising them.
